The Day the Internet Stood Still
On Monday, a significant disruption in Amazon Web Services (AWS) sent shockwaves across the global digital landscape, bringing numerous high-profile platforms to a grinding halt. The outage, which began in the early hours of the morning ET, impacted everything from e-commerce and financial services to social media and entertainment, highlighting the immense reliance on cloud infrastructure in today’s interconnected world.

Scope of the Disruption
The AWS outage had a domino effect, crippling services across multiple sectors. E-commerce giants like Amazon’s own storefront and Prime services were inaccessible, while smart home devices such as Alexa and Ring fell silent. Financial platforms including Venmo and Robinhood experienced interruptions, disrupting transactions for millions. Communication tools like Slack and Signal, along with ride-sharing services such as Lyft, were also affected, underscoring the widespread dependency on AWS’s infrastructure.
Entertainment and social platforms weren’t spared either. Services like Snapchat, Reddit, and major streaming platforms including Prime Video, HBO Max, Disney+, and Hulu faced downtime. Gaming communities felt the impact as well, with platforms like Roblox, Fortnite, and Steam going offline, leaving players in limbo. AWS’s Response and Root Cause Analysis
In an update on its service dashboard, AWS identified the issue as stemming from “error rates for the DynamoDB APIs in the US-EAST-1 Region,” which were linked to DNS resolution problems. The company assured users that it was working diligently to resolve the matter and later reported “significant signs of recovery,” with most requests beginning to succeed again. User Reactions and Social Media Fallout
As services went down, users flocked to still-functioning platforms like X (formerly Twitter) and Bluesky to voice their frustrations. The outage sparked a mix of lamentations over lost productivity and the usual humorous takes that accompany such internet meltdowns. This event underscores how integral these services have become to daily life, from work and finance to leisure and social interaction.
